Context: The DeSci-Web3 Bridge
DeSci, or decentralized science, has been a niche narrative in crypto since 2021. Projects like VitaDAO, Molecule, and ResearchHub tokenize IP and fund early-stage research. But the sector has lacked a catalyst—a macro event that justifies capital rotation from the legacy Pharma pipeline into on-chain research capital markets. Amodei's prediction, while lacking technical specifics, provides exactly that: a narrative anchor. It reframes AI-driven biotech from a speculative venture into a near-term inevitability, and by extension, positions the crypto rails that support it as essential infrastructure.
Crypto's role in this story is not about curing diseases on-chain. It's about funding, data provenance, and compute resource allocation. The tokenization of biotech IP allows fractional ownership of drug discovery assets. Bio data NFTs can encode genomic and proteomic datasets with privacy-preserving access controls. And compute tokens—like those powering decentralized GPU networks (Akash, Render, io.net)—become the fuel for AI protein folding simulations. Contrarian: Shorting the Illusion of Permanence
Here's the devil's advocate pivot. The "AI cures most diseases" claim is a high-risk narrative. It lacks technical specificity, clinical validation, and fails to address the "death valley" of FDA trials. If the prediction fails to materialize within the promised window, the DeSci bubble could deflate rapidly, leaving token holders with illiquid IP and depreciated compute tokens.
Moreover, the regulatory gulf is daunting. Tokenized biotech IP crosses securities laws, data privacy regulations (HIPAA, GDPR), and clinical trial oversight. The SEC could classify bioactive data NFTs as investment contracts, triggering registration requirements. The EU's MiCA framework already has provisions that could extend to tokenized health data. I've seen this regulatory overhang kill narratives before—remember the 2021 medical data tokenization wave? It died when the SEC sent a single Wells notice.
Crypto's liquidity is a double-edged sword. It enables rapid capital deployment, but also rapid exit. The same mechanism that allows a DAO to raise $100 million for a longevity research project also allows whales to dump their governance tokens the moment the first clinical trial fails.
